QUALITY STARTS BEFORE PRODUCTION

Quality control starts with the approved specification.

For custom stainless steel products, quality cannot be separated from the agreed drawings, material, finish, dimensions, assembly details and inspection points.

A custom product is only checkable when the acceptance basis is clear. That is why AOJIPOER connects quality control with the approved project scope instead of treating inspection as a final formality.

Custom stainless steel work becomes easier to quote, manufacture and inspect when the project facts are written down before production begins.

  • Drawing revision controlThe approved drawing or requirement version is used as the basis for quotation and production checks.
  • Dimensional checksCritical dimensions, openings, fixing positions and assembly interfaces are checked against the agreed scope.
  • Surface reviewFinish direction, visible surfaces, color consistency, polishing level and handling marks are reviewed according to references.
  • Assembly and fitting checksDoors, panels, shelves, frames, modules and related interfaces are reviewed before packing when applicable.
  • Packing reviewFinished surfaces and accessories are protected according to shipment and handling risks.

What should be defined before quality inspection?

Useful inspection criteria include drawings, dimensions, material, finish reference, visible surfaces, assembly details, packaging and destination requirements.
